COVID-19: Funke Akindele prays for pregnant women, newborn babies

Funke Akindele Funke Akindele

Nollywood star, Funke Akindele, has expressed her thoughts towards all pregnant women as the world battles the deadly coronavirus pandemic.

The actress who recently completed her 14-days community service as part punishment for defying social distancing order took to social media to say a word of prayer for the expectant mothers.

"The Lord will keep them all safe and we will only hear good news from their camps!! AMEN!!!," she said on Twitter.

In her Instagram story, the actress said, "Prayers for all the pregnant women and newborn babies during this pandemic attack. May they all be safe and sound in Jesus name."

The prayer is one timely action by the actress as records show that pregnant women and their babies are not immune from the dead;y virus.

About eight babies were reportedly diagnosed with the deadly virus in Japan, according to reports, while some pregnant women have also been diagnosed with the virus that has also killed at least one baby in places like the US and the UK.

In Nigeria, a 29-year-old pregnant woman was confirmed positive some days ago, only to die on Wednesday from the virus, leaving behind her newborn baby, according to Governor Ayodele Fayemi of Ekiti state.
